The Norwalk Art Space is proud to announce its next exhibition, “American Iconography” with Korry Fellow Tara Blackwell and invited artist Cal Bocicault. Daily life is filled with repetitive images and public figures that symbolize our time, place, and shared collective history. These images are sometimes remembered fondly through our childhood lenses, while others may have altered our perceptions of the neighbor next door. This exhibition explores the power of imagery as a vessel to create change in our collective futures. Here we have two distinctly different artists that use iconic American imagery to reference and push the boundaries of feminism, social justice, and African American identity.

Join us for a Panel of Art Professionals at TNAS! Forging a career in the arts is never a simple, straightforward, nor easy endeavor, but there is simply nothing more rewarding for those of us called to the arts. We want to open up space for high school and college-aged art students to learn more about what it takes to build a career in the arts at this panel, where students' questions will drive the discussion with artists at TNAS. All questions and curiosities welcome! Six mid- to late-career artists form our panel on December 18th. These Korry Fellows are working at The Norwalk Art Space for the 2021-2022 year as mentors for earlier-career artists as well as local high school students.
